Was this useful? We really enjoyed the Cheung Fatt Tze Mansion and their excellant UNESCO tour guide who explains the integration of chi and fengshui into Chinese Architecture. They do tours once or twice a day - make sure to come at the right time. However, they dont allow you to take photos inside. Its not budget but you can stay at the mansion too, I wish we had! If you're big into architecture go also to the Pinang Peranakan Mansion which offers no tours but allows photographs inside. Fort Cornwallis is a good place to stock up on local history and town is filled with fantastic architecture from colonial and ethnic roots. Take the bus out to Penang Hill and ride the cable car up to the top. There are a number of temples and a small bird zoo which are neat to explore. We were lucky enough to see some wild gibbons in the bush along one of the roads, which are nice and quite to walk along and good for nature spotting; birds, insects etc. Watch out for the naughty macaques though! |
